I forlængelse af min tidligere post.
Som sagt, har jeg en usb-disk, der ikke når at komme med, før der mountes.
Disken sidder på en sata->usb-konverter.
Root mount waiting for: usbus1 usbus0
uhub0: 3 ports with 3 removable, self powered
uhub1: 3 ports with 3 removable, self powered
usb2_set_config_index:490: could not read device status: USB_ERR_SHORT_XFER
ugen0.2: <JMicron> at usbus0
umass0: <MSC Bulk-Only Transfer> on usbus0
umass0: SCSI over Bulk-Only; quirks = 0x0000
Root mount waiting for: usbus0
umass0:0:0:-1: Attached to scbus0
Trying to mount root from ufs:/dev/mirror/gm0s1a
Her prøves også at mounte /var og /usr på da0 men den er ikke klar endnu.
da0 at umass-sim0 bus 0 target 0 lun 0
da0: <SAMSUNG HD103UI 1113> Fixed Direct Access SCSI-2 device
da0: 1.000MB/s transfers
da0: 953869MB (1953525168 512 byte sectors: 255H 63S/T 121601C)
GEOM: da0s1: geometry does not match label (16h,63s != 255h,63s).
Først nu er da0 klar, men det er for sent.
Kan man ikke vente på at da0 er klar?
Så vidt jeg kan se i /usr/src/sys/kern/vfs_mount.c
ventes på at usb-bussen er oppe, men det er jo ikke nok, hvis disken
derefter skal bruge tid på at blive klar og attaches til systemet.
Kan der skrives noget i boot/loader.conf?
Leif
|